About Antonio Baldi
Antonio Baldi is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Mechanics of Materials, Biomedical Engineering and Media Technology, having authored 60 papers that have together received 736 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Optical measurement and interference techniques (26 papers), Welding Techniques and Residual Stresses (11 papers), Image Processing Techniques and Applications (10 papers), Advanced Surface Polishing Techniques (10 papers), Advanced Vision and Imaging (8 papers), Advanced Measurement and Metrology Techniques (8 papers), Adhesion, Friction, and Surface Interactions (7 papers) and Thermography and Photoacoustic Techniques (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(276 citations), Mechanical Engineering (424 citations), Media Technology (95 citations), Civil and Structural Engineering (145 citations) and Mechanics of Materials (162 citations). Antonio Baldi has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, United States and France. Frequent co-authors include G. Carta, Michele Brun, Massimiliano Pau, Francesco Ginesu, L. Francesconi, Michael Taylor, Bruno Leban, Xudong Liang, Francesco Aymerich and Katia Bertoldi. Their work appears in journals such as Experimental Mechanics, Optics and Lasers in Engineering, International Journal of Solids and Structures, Wear and Meccanica.
